MUNDANE MYSTERIES: The REAL reason hotels have free ice machines

A lot of summer vacations happening which means you’re probably staying in a lot of hotel rooms. Every hotel stay you get the essentials… black out curtains, little soaps, maybe a bible in the drawer, and free ice! But the ice wasn’t always free.

Back in the day refrigeration wasn’t what it is now and ice was expensive so hotels used to charge for it. But you can thank Holiday Inn for it being free now. The founder of Holiday Inn couldn’t compete with the other hotel chains so they decided to just make all their ice free for guests and that would be their hook. It worked. In fact, it worked so well that it obviously caught on over the years and every hotel started doing it.

So now you know the reason why you get that little bucket and free cubes next time you’re in a hotel room.

MUNDANE MYSTERIES: PEZ was originally invented for WHAT?!

PEZ, who’s visitor center is right here in Orange, CT, was not meant as a fun candy at all. It started as more of a mint type item to help people quit smoking.

The creator or PEZ who was Austrian named the candies after the German word for peppermint (Pffefferminz). They were first released in 1927 as round mints sold in tins, almost like Altoids that we have now. The fun toy dispensers we all know and love came later.

TELL ME SOMETHING GOOD: Lifelong Flight Attendant Sets New World Record

With all the headaches happening with airlines, airports, and summer travel lately I figured we need nice feel good airline stories anytime we can get them.

Like this 86-year-old woman from Boston, Bette Nash, who just set a world record as the longest-serving flight attendant ever! She got hired back in 1957 when plane tickets were hand written and only cost $12. (I don’t even think you can buy a bottle of water for that price nowadays). 65 years later she’s still up in the skies going strong in the aisles for American Airlines. She says she has no plans to retire anytime soon.
